Born in the United States and taken back to Iran as an infant, Missaghi grew up free on paper but trapped in practice. At 7 years old, he was expelled from school for the first time in Tehran — not for misbehavior or poor grades, but for belonging to a faith the Islamic Republic refused to recognize. In post-revolutionary Iran, being Baha’i meant fractured futures: no university, no profession, no way to support a family. Yet hidden in a dresser drawer was a golden ticket: a United States passport quietly renewed every five years in secret. As adolescence gave way to urgency, Missaghi had to decide whether hope was worth the risk of escape. With surveillance closing in and many doors slammed shut, he faced an unthinkable choice: remain invisible or gamble everything on a document that could save or destroy him. He left his native Iran after the completion of high school due to being deprived of access to higher education as a religious minority in the Islamic Republic. He completed his undergraduate studies at the University of Virginia and pursued his medical education at Virginia Commonwealth University School of Medicine. After completion of his residency in anesthesiology, he moved to the Phoenix metro area, where he is a founding member of Grand Canyon Anesthesia and a clinical assistant professor of anesthesiology at the University of Arizona School of Medicine and Midwestern University.

Burnout,which is estimated to cost the USover $500B every year, is defined by the World Health Organization (WHO) as “anoccupational phenomenon resulting from chronic stress that has not beensuccessfully managed.” But what ifBurnout isn’t just about overwork, too little rest, or setting poor boundaries,as is often assumed? What if it’s about Betrayal Trauma? Many peoplearen’t just tired or overwhelmed; they’re disoriented. The institutions andidentity narratives that have shaped how they understand fairness, opportunity,justice, and stability feel less predictable. When systems shift faster thanidentity can adapt, the nervous system registers a threat. The result lookslike overwhelm, outrage, shutdown, or exhaustion — but underneath it isidentity disruption, the precursor to Betrayal Trauma. Thesymptoms of Burnout and Betrayal Trauma are strikingly similar, yet their rootcauses are very different. Recognizing the difference is key to a productivesolution.
